Transaction 32a3c1102f4e787ccee2bc50b674c091a8eb0ca65c148cfdb9fc7cda10232009

1 Input
2 Outputs
  • 32a3c1102f4e787ccee2bc50b674c091a8eb0ca65c148cfdb9fc7cda10232009:0
  • value  10727942
    address  1BFvYftfmT3wPv67bk2uxn8Zw86P2Vm5DG
  • 32a3c1102f4e787ccee2bc50b674c091a8eb0ca65c148cfdb9fc7cda10232009:1
  • value  7439371320
    address  1X65Xv7y6xVhQx12BBpJPqeYVLnG1FGkt